整理页面toolbar,修复开服表跨年显示异常问题
This commit is contained in:
@ -4,7 +4,6 @@ import android.content.Context;
|
||||
import android.content.Intent;
|
||||
import android.os.Bundle;
|
||||
|
||||
import com.gh.base.BaseActivity;
|
||||
import com.gh.common.util.EntranceUtils;
|
||||
import com.gh.gamecenter.download.DownloadFragment;
|
||||
|
||||
@ -13,7 +12,7 @@ import com.gh.gamecenter.download.DownloadFragment;
|
||||
*
|
||||
* @author 黄壮华
|
||||
*/
|
||||
public class DownloadManagerActivity extends BaseActivity {
|
||||
public class DownloadManagerActivity extends NormalActivity {
|
||||
|
||||
public static final int INDEX_DOWNLOAD = 0;
|
||||
public static final int INDEX_UPDATE = 1;
|
||||
@ -22,51 +21,53 @@ public class DownloadManagerActivity extends BaseActivity {
|
||||
public static final String TAG = "DownloadManagerActivity";
|
||||
|
||||
|
||||
// TODO: 20/09/17 增加currentItem 入口 插件更新可能需要
|
||||
public static Intent getDownloadMangerIntent(Context context, String url, String entrance) {
|
||||
Intent intent = new Intent(context, DownloadManagerActivity.class);
|
||||
intent.putExtra(EntranceUtils.KEY_URL, url);
|
||||
intent.putExtra(EntranceUtils.KEY_ENTRANCE, entrance);
|
||||
return intent;
|
||||
// Intent intent = new Intent(context, DownloadManagerActivity.class);
|
||||
// intent.putExtra(EntranceUtils.KEY_URL, url);
|
||||
// intent.putExtra(EntranceUtils.KEY_ENTRANCE, entrance);
|
||||
Bundle bundle = new Bundle();
|
||||
bundle.putString(EntranceUtils.KEY_URL, url);
|
||||
bundle.putString(EntranceUtils.KEY_ENTRANCE, entrance);
|
||||
return getIntent(context, DownloadFragment.class, bundle);
|
||||
}
|
||||
|
||||
public static void startDownloadManagerActivity(Context context, String url, String entrance) {
|
||||
Intent intent = new Intent(context, DownloadManagerActivity.class);
|
||||
intent.putExtra(EntranceUtils.KEY_URL, url);
|
||||
intent.putExtra(EntranceUtils.KEY_ENTRANCE, entrance);
|
||||
intent.setFlags(Intent.FLAG_ACTIVITY_NEW_TASK);
|
||||
context.startActivity(intent);
|
||||
}
|
||||
// public static void startDownloadManagerActivity(Context context, String url, String entrance) {
|
||||
// Intent intent = new Intent(context, DownloadManagerActivity.class);
|
||||
// intent.putExtra(EntranceUtils.KEY_URL, url);
|
||||
// intent.putExtra(EntranceUtils.KEY_ENTRANCE, entrance);
|
||||
// intent.setFlags(Intent.FLAG_ACTIVITY_NEW_TASK);
|
||||
// context.startActivity(intent);
|
||||
// }
|
||||
//
|
||||
// @Override
|
||||
// protected int getLayoutId() {
|
||||
// return R.layout.activity_downloadmanager;
|
||||
// }
|
||||
|
||||
@Override
|
||||
protected int getLayoutId() {
|
||||
return R.layout.activity_downloadmanager;
|
||||
}
|
||||
|
||||
@Override
|
||||
protected void onCreate(Bundle savedInstanceState) {
|
||||
super.onCreate(savedInstanceState);
|
||||
|
||||
setNavigationTitle(getString(R.string.title_downloadmanager));
|
||||
|
||||
startDownloadFragment();
|
||||
}
|
||||
|
||||
private void startDownloadFragment() {
|
||||
int currentItem = getIntent().getIntExtra(EntranceUtils.KEY_CURRENTITEM, 0);
|
||||
Bundle data = getIntent().getBundleExtra(EntranceUtils.KEY_DATA);
|
||||
if (data != null) {
|
||||
currentItem = data.getInt(EntranceUtils.KEY_CURRENTITEM, 0);
|
||||
}
|
||||
|
||||
getSupportFragmentManager().beginTransaction().replace(
|
||||
R.id.layout_fragment_content, DownloadFragment.newInstance(currentItem)).commitAllowingStateLoss();
|
||||
}
|
||||
|
||||
@Override
|
||||
protected void onNewIntent(Intent intent) {
|
||||
super.onNewIntent(intent);
|
||||
startDownloadFragment();
|
||||
setIntent(intent);
|
||||
}
|
||||
// @Override
|
||||
// protected void onCreate(Bundle savedInstanceState) {
|
||||
// super.onCreate(savedInstanceState);
|
||||
//
|
||||
// setNavigationTitle(getString(R.string.title_downloadmanager));
|
||||
//
|
||||
// startDownloadFragment();
|
||||
// }
|
||||
//
|
||||
// private void startDownloadFragment() {
|
||||
// int currentItem = getIntent().getIntExtra(EntranceUtils.KEY_CURRENTITEM, 0);
|
||||
// Bundle data = getIntent().getBundleExtra(EntranceUtils.KEY_DATA);
|
||||
// if (data != null) {
|
||||
// currentItem = data.getInt(EntranceUtils.KEY_CURRENTITEM, 0);
|
||||
// }
|
||||
//
|
||||
// getSupportFragmentManager().beginTransaction().replace(
|
||||
// R.id.layout_fragment_content, DownloadFragment.newInstance(currentItem)).commitAllowingStateLoss();
|
||||
// }
|
||||
//
|
||||
// @Override
|
||||
// protected void onNewIntent(Intent intent) {
|
||||
// super.onNewIntent(intent);
|
||||
// startDownloadFragment();
|
||||
// setIntent(intent);
|
||||
// }
|
||||
}
|
||||
Reference in New Issue
Block a user